Pfizer is seeking a senior leader in Data Science to build and lead a best-in-class team focused on Marketing Mix Modeling (MMM) within commercial analytics. This role is responsible for hands-on development and deployment of MMM solutions, driving actionable insights for marketing optimization and ROI. The ideal candidate combines deep technical expertise in MMM with a consulting background, enabling strategic influence across multiple markets and business units. You will collaborate cross-functionally to empower data-driven decision-making, accelerate marketing transformation, and deliver measurable business impact.
ROLE RESPONSIBILITIES
- This role is accountable for delivering data science driven insights & solutions and will partner with senior functional leads for across Commercial analytics to develop and implement models, insights, and data products that drive brands’ strategic priorities.
- Lead end to end design, implementation, and refinement of marketing mix models to measure and optimize the effectiveness of marketing channels and tactics (DTC, HCP paid media, emerging platforms).
- Lead the evolution of analytics methods and processes for Promotion Impact Analytics, Resource Allocation & Optimization at the enterprise level via both technology and process enhancements.
- Build, validate, and deploy econometric and machine learning models (regression, time series, Bayesian, causal inference) for marketing ROI analysis and budget allocation.
- Partner with marketing, media, agencies and commercial teams to evaluate campaign performance, forecast outcomes, and recommend strategic investments.
- Develop and oversee A/B tests, incrementality studies, and causal inference approaches to validate marketing impact.
- Ensure robust data pipelines, data quality, and governance for marketing analytics datasets.
- Lead cross functional team of data scientists & data engineers fostering innovation, technical excellence, and continuous learning.
- Present insights and recommendations to senior stakeholders in clear, actionable formats.
- Drive adoption of advanced MMM methodologies, including ad-stock, saturation, and response curve modeling.
- Stay abreast of latest MMM tools, platforms, and industry best practices.
